Senior Data Scientist - Operations (Remote)
About the Role
InPost is seeking a talented and passionate Senior Data Scientist - Operations (Remote) to join our dynamic teams. As a Senior Data Scientist, you will leverage advanced analytical techniques and machine learning models to extract actionable insights from our complex data sets, driving strategic decision-making and operational excellence.
What You'll Do
- Partner with our Product and Business Teams to understand their needs, translating them into data science solutions and providing actionable insights.
- Develop and implement advanced data science solutions, including machine learning models, AI products, and optimization frameworks.
-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to ensure seamless integration of data-driven initiatives.
- Stay ahead of the curve by exploring cutting-edge methods and keeping up with new trends in Data Science & AI.
- Communicate insights and recommendations to management, business teams, and other data community members.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s, Master’s, or PhD degree in a relevant field such as data science, computer science, mathematics, statistics, econometrics, or physics.
- At least 3 years of experience working with data science methods.
- Strong technical and/or research background is a plus.
- Proficiency in English and Polish; knowledge of other languages is a plus.
- Excellent knowledge of ML solutions and their impact on business, user experience, and operational processes.
- Hands-on experience working with large amounts of data.
- Proficiency in Python 3 and ML/data analysis libraries (e.g., Pandas, Numpy, Scipy, Scikit-learn, TF/Pytorch).
- Experience with PySpark, relational databases, and cloud solutions (e.g., Databricks, Azure, GCP, AWS, Snowflake).
